How To Pick A Laptop For 3D Modeling

Best laptops for 3D modeling and rendering Buying Guide

The key specs that make a good laptop for 3D modeling and rendering are RAM, CPU, GPU, and resolution, though some others like screen size still help when 3D modeling.

While less demanding software like AutoCAD and Fusion 360 can run on cheaper CPUs and GPUS, and less than 16GB RAM, the top solutions like Maya and 3DS Max require powerful chips, graphics cards, and 32GB RAM for optimal performance. 

Here’s a look at the minimum laptop specs for 3D modeling software, comparing some of the most popular solutions for modeling and rendering:

Software Minimum RAMRecommended RAMCPU (minimum cores)
Fusion 3604GB6GB 4-core
AutoCAD8GB16GB4-core
Rhino8GB16-32GB2-core
Blender8GB16-32GB4-core
3DS Max8GB16-32GB8-core
Maya16GB32GB8-core
Minimum laptop specs for 3D modeling software

RAM 

RAM (random access memory) is a cornerstone for 3D modeling and rendering. It’s where the processor temporarily stores data for quick access.

While some entry-level 3D software can operate on 4GB RAM, advanced programs like Maya demand at least 32GB for seamless performance with intricate models.

Operating System Compatibility with Software

Not all software is universally compatible across all laptop platforms.

For instance, while Solidworks and 3DS Max are staples in the industry, they’re not accessible on Mac systems.

Conversely, Fusion 360 and AutoCAD, despite their popularity, aren’t available on Linux.

Windows laptops stand out in this regard, offering the broadest compatibility with a myriad of 3D modeling applications. This makes them a versatile choice for those who work with multiple software or are still exploring their options.

What is the minimum laptop requirement for 3D rendering?

For a lot of 3D modeling, you can get away with 8GB RAM, a 64-bit Core i5 chip or higher, and a decent graphics card. However, demanding programs like Maya require more processing power and at least 16GB RAM and 32GB for optimal performance, along with at least an 8-core CPU.

Do you need a lot of RAM for 3D modeling?

Yes, RAM has a big impact on how smoothly your computer handles 3D modeling. Basic programs like Fusion 360 can run on 4GB RAM, but for programs like Blender and Maya 32GB is recommended.

What processor do I need for 3D modeling?

The 16-core AMD Ryzen 3950 X is one of the most powerful processors for 3D modeling, although 8-core and above Intel chips, as well as Apple’s M2 chip, are also suitable for many of the top modeling and rendering applications.

Do you need a good graphics card for 3D modeling?

Yes, a powerful graphics card is required for running demanding 3D modeling programs like Blender and 3DS Max. NVIDIA GPUs are the most popular (particularly the GeForce 3070, 3080, and 3090 graphics cards).
